Text

(a)The county home superintendent shall, with the approval of the county home board, appoint as many assistants as the superintendent and the county home board determine to be necessary to do the following:
(1)Administer the activities and services of the county home.
(2)Provide proper and adequate care for patients and residents.
(3)Perform all other duties required of the county.
(b)Assistants must be appointed under this section solely on the basis of qualification and training for the duties assigned and without regard to political affiliation.
(c)The county home superintendent shall, with the approval of the county home board, fix the compensation of the assistants appointed under this section within the lawfully established appropriations.
